I began to get a feeling familiar to me from my bartending days of being the only sane man in a nuthouse. It doesn't make you feel superior but depressed and scared, because there is nobody you can contact.
Interpretation
What this quote means
The quote reflects the feeling of isolation and despair when one perceives a lack of sanity in the surrounding environment.
In this quote, William S. Burroughs expresses the loneliness and emotional turmoil that comes from recognizing one's own sanity in a chaotic or irrational world. It highlights the existential struggle faced when an individual feels out of place or unable to relate to others, evoking emotions of fear and depression rather than superiority. This perspective not only critiques societal norms but also sheds light on the challenges of connecting with those around us.
